The $884 million acquisition of the Santiago, Chile-based company should enhance Air Products’ growth opportunities in the region. The deal will position Air Products as the second-largest industrial gas producer in Latin America, a region second in growth only to Asia, the company says. By taking a majority stake in Indura, Air Products will extend its Latin American presence to 12 countries, enabling it to benefit from greater economies of scale and a large talent pool to service multinational customers in more markets, Air Products says.
Indura businesses, with total annual sales of $478 million, include liquid bulk, small on-sites and packaged gases. For more information, go to www.airproducts.com.
